Can't pay your Council Tax

If you are having any difficulty in paying your Council Tax don't just stop paying! Get in touch with the Council Tax team immediately so that we can offer you advice.

If you can make any payment at all, pay as much as you can, even if it's not the full instalment amount. Get in touch with the Council Tax team immediately so that we can offer you advice and discuss your circumstances. We will guide you through what might happen next and will always try to make an affordable payment plan to prevent you from falling further behind and into even more arrears. 

Our team can discuss your circumstances to see if you may be entitled to claim a Council Tax discount, exemption or reduction.

If you're on a low income you may qualify for Local Council Tax Support (LCTS) which is administered by our benefits team.

Local Council Tax Support (LCTS)

Local Council Tax Support (LCTS) has replaced the national Council Tax Benefit scheme and is provided to people on low incomes to help with their Council Tax bill.

Exceptional Hardship Fund (EHF)

This fund has been set up to provide short term relief for our most vulnerable customers who have seen a reduction in the Government support which helped to pay their Council Tax liability or for those who are suffering financial hardship due to unforeseen circumstances.
